#63f797 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#63f797 is composed of 38.8% red, 96.9% green and 59.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.9% yellow and 3.1% black. It has a hue angle of 141.1 degrees, a saturation of 90.2% and a lightness of 67.8%. #63f797 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ffff with #00ef2f. Closest websafe color is: #66ff99.

Shades and Tints of #63f797

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010c05 is the darkest color, while #f8fffb is the lightest one.
